Skip to Content

 

OpenCart ↔ Odoo Connector

Fully integrated, every version — with true real-time bidirectional sync.

PRODUCT & CATALOG

Product Management

  • Bidirectional product sync (Odoo ↔ OpenCart)
  • Simple & configurable product support
  • Product options & option values sync
  • Product templates & variants mapping
  • Product images (main + gallery)
  • Short & full description sync
  • Product tags & meta keywords
  • SEO URL, meta title & description
  • Digital / downloadable product support
  • Real-time product push (Odoo 18+)

Categories & Pricing

  • Bidirectional category hierarchy sync
  • Category images & descriptions
  • Manufacturer / brand data sync
  • Odoo pricelist → OpenCart product price
  • Customer group pricing sync
  • Special / sale price with date range
  • Multi-currency pricing per store
  • Tax class mapping (OC → Odoo fiscal position)
  • Coupon / discount code sync

INVENTORY & ORDERS

Inventory Management

  • Real-time stock sync (Odoo → OpenCart)
  • Stock sync on every OpenCart sale
  • Multi-warehouse stock routing
  • Lot & serial number tracking
  • Prevent overselling with live stock lock
  • Reorder rule auto-trigger on OC sale
  • Batch stock updates via queue processing
  • Barcode scan → OpenCart stock update
  • AI demand forecasting for replenishment

Order Management

  • Auto-import OpenCart orders → Odoo SO
  • Bidirectional order status sync
  • Order cancel sync on both platforms
  • Tax, coupon & discount line mapping
  • Webhook instant order push (create/complete/cancel/refund)
  • Auto-workflow (confirm → invoice → ship)
  • Guest order import with auto customer create
  • Order comment / gift message sync
  • AI risk scoring on incoming orders

Shipping & Returns​

  • Carrier & shipping method sync
  • Tracking number push → OpenCart
  • Auto-mark "Shipped" in OpenCart
  • Dropshipping auto PO creation
  • Return / RMA in Odoo → credit note to OC
  • Refund sync (OC refund → Odoo credit note)
  • DHL / FedEx / UPS label generation
  • Click & collect / in-store pickup

Customer & CRM

  • Customer import (name, email, address)
  • Bulk customer import with address mapping
  • Customer group → Odoo partner tag/pricelist
  • Manual customer mapping (OC ↔ Odoo)
  • Auto CRM lead creation from OC order
  • Lead pipeline tracking & won status sync
  • Purchase history → Odoo CRM 360 view
  • Newsletter / subscription status sync
  • AI customer segmentation
  • Abandoned cart → Odoo CRM opportunity

Accounting & Finance

  • Auto-invoice from OpenCart orders
  • Payment method → Odoo journal mapping
  • Tax rules & fiscal position auto-assign
  • Refund & credit note sync
  • Multi-currency support & reconciliation
  • Shipping charge tax calculation
  • Stripe / PayPal / Razorpay sync
  • Bank reconciliation automation
  • Financial compliance & audit reports

Marketing & Loyalty

  • OpenCart reward points ↔ Odoo loyalty sync
  • Loyalty points expiry management
  • Affiliate commission sync → Odoo accounting
  • Gift voucher / store credit sync
  • Email campaign segmentation via Odoo
  • WhatsApp / SMS order notification
  • Mailchimp / Klaviyo customer list sync
  • Product review import to Odoo CRM

    ADVANCED, MULTI-STORE & AI

Automation & Sync Engine

  • Webhook: order create / complete / cancel / refund
  • Scheduled cron jobs (configurable intervals)
  • Queue Job (OCA) for async reliable sync
  • Rate-limited API calls & batch processing
  • Auto-workflow rule engine
  • Mismatch / error log with reasons
  • Retry failed sync queue
  • In-conversation order status notifications

Analytics & AI (OC 4.x)

  • Unified KPI dashboard (OC + Odoo)
  • Real-time KPI widgets & interactive charts
  • Revenue by store / product / category
  • AI product recommendations sync
  • AI inventory risk scoring
  • Customer LTV & segmentation report
  • Sync history & full audit log
  • Power BI / Looker Studio export

Multi-store & International

  • Multiple OC stores → 1 Odoo database
  • Isolated config per store instance
  • Multi-language product content sync
  • Multi-currency pricing per store
  • Country-based tax & fiscal rules
  • Store-wise order & inventory view in Odoo
  • 100% translatable storefront via OC 

POS & Omnichannel

  • Odoo POS ↔ OpenCart inventory sync
  • POS loyalty points linked to OC reward points
  • Unified customer across POS + online
  • In-store return reflected in OpenCart
  • Click & collect order type support
  • Offline POS sync on reconnect
  • Affiliate payout via Odoo accounting